当前位置: 首页 > 伪类选择器

     伪类选择器
         18570人感兴趣  ●  584次引用
  • 获取元素期望样式的教程

    获取元素期望样式的教程

    本文旨在提供一种获取元素期望CSS属性的方法,即使这些样式是通过JavaScript动态设置的。传统的`getComputedStyle`方法返回的是元素最终应用的样式,而本文介绍的方法则能够提取开发者在样式表或内联样式中定义的原始样式,并考虑到CSS规则的优先级,帮助开发者更准确地了解元素的设计意图。

    html教程 8312025-09-14 23:07:01

  • CSS教程:精细控制连续<sup>元素的间距

    CSS教程:精细控制连续<sup>元素的间距

    本文详细介绍了如何通过CSS精确控制连续元素之间的多余空白。针对默认浏览器样式可能导致上标内容之间出现不必要的间距问题,教程提供了使用负margin-left结合:not(:first-child)伪类选择器的方法,以实现更紧凑、专业的排版效果,提升文本可读性。

    html教程 4352025-09-14 15:02:01

  • CSS技巧:精确控制连续上标(<sup>)元素的间距

    CSS技巧:精确控制连续上标(<sup>)元素的间距

    本文探讨了如何有效减少HTML中连续元素之间不必要的空白间距。通过利用CSS伪类选择器:not(:first-child)结合负外边距margin-left,可以精确控制除第一个上标外的所有后续上标元素的位置,实现更紧凑的视觉效果。文章还建议在可能的情况下,合并多个上标以简化结构。

    html教程 6362025-09-14 14:41:00

  • 减少连续 <sup> 元素间距的CSS技巧

    减少连续 <sup> 元素间距的CSS技巧

    本教程旨在解决HTML中连续元素之间出现的额外空白问题。通过利用CSS的:not(:first-child)选择器结合负margin-left属性,我们可以精确地控制并消除非首个元素左侧的不必要间距,从而实现紧凑且专业的上标排版效果,提升页面视觉一致性。

    html教程 4222025-09-14 14:38:03

  • CSS技巧:优化连续上标元素间的间距

    CSS技巧:优化连续上标元素间的间距

    本教程旨在解决HTML中连续元素之间出现额外空白的问题。通过应用CSS负外边距(margin-left)并结合:not(:first-child)伪类选择器,我们可以精确控制除第一个上标外的所有后续上标的定位,从而消除不必要的间距,实现更紧凑、专业的文本排版效果。

    html教程 3542025-09-14 14:32:03

  • CSS代码怎么调试_CSS代码调试技巧与工具使用

    CSS代码怎么调试_CSS代码调试技巧与工具使用

    首先使用浏览器开发者工具快速定位CSS错误,通过Elements面板查看元素样式及覆盖情况,结合搜索功能查找相关规则,并利用Stylelint等工具检测语法与风格问题;接着针对优先级冲突,依据选择器权重和声明顺序调整,避免滥用!important,推荐使用更具体的选择器或CSS预处理器管理样式;对于响应式布局调试,借助设备模拟功能测试不同屏幕尺寸,合理运用媒体查询、Flexbox与Grid布局技术,并在多设备上验证兼容性;最后优化CSS性能,通过压缩合并文件、减少复杂选择器、使用CSSSprit

    css教程 8342025-09-13 23:29:01

  • CSS优先级怎么计算_CSS优先级计算规则详解

    CSS优先级怎么计算_CSS优先级计算规则详解

    答案是CSS优先级通过选择器类型和声明方式的权重累加决定,!important最高但应慎用,开发者工具可帮助排查冲突。

    css教程 8942025-09-13 22:40:02

  • CSS实现悬停触发:利用相邻兄弟选择器和Flexbox控制元素显示

    CSS实现悬停触发:利用相邻兄弟选择器和Flexbox控制元素显示

    本教程详细讲解如何利用CSS的相邻兄弟选择器(+)和Flexbox布局,实现在一个div上悬停时显示另一个div中的内容。文章分析了常见错误,并提供了优化后的HTML结构和CSS样式,确保元素按预期响应悬停事件,提升用户交互体验。

    html教程 1632025-09-13 13:34:47

  • CSS继承特性怎么用_CSS属性继承特性应用解析

    CSS继承特性怎么用_CSS属性继承特性应用解析

    CSS属性继承指部分样式如color、font-family等从父元素传给子元素,主要用于文本样式,而box模型属性不继承;可通过inherit、initial、unset等关键字控制继承行为,结合特异性与层叠规则,继承值优先级较低,常作为fallback机制;利用CSS自定义属性(变量)可增强继承的可控性与灵活性,实现主题切换与集中管理,提升代码可维护性。

    css教程 3382025-09-12 18:00:04

  • CSS表格样式如何美化_CSS美化表格样式技巧分享

    CSS表格样式如何美化_CSS美化表格样式技巧分享

    使用CSS选择器控制表格样式,通过table、th、td和伪类实现基础美化与隔行变色;利用Grid或Flexbox优化布局,提升灵活性;通过overflow-x:auto实现响应式滚动;添加:hover高亮交互效果,并结合JavaScript实现排序功能;选用易读字体与高对比度配色增强可读性。

    css教程 10712025-09-11 20:25:01

  • 使用Selenium与CSS选择器:动态网页数据提取实战指南

    使用Selenium与CSS选择器:动态网页数据提取实战指南

    本教程旨在详细阐述如何利用SeleniumWebDriver结合CSS选择器高效地从JavaScript驱动的动态网页中提取结构化数据。文章将涵盖Selenium环境配置、元素定位核心方法、动态内容加载(如“加载更多”按钮)的处理策略,并通过一个实际案例演示如何抓取产品标题、URL、图片URL、价格等关键信息,最终提供CSS选择器优化技巧及数据抓取时的注意事项,助力开发者构建稳定且可扩展的网页数据抓取脚本。

    Python教程 6132025-09-08 16:54:01

  • 精准CSS选择:利用:not组合选择器排除特定元素及其直接子元素

    精准CSS选择:利用:not组合选择器排除特定元素及其直接子元素

    本文探讨了如何利用CSS的:not伪类选择器,以实现对HTML结构中特定元素及其直接子元素的精确排除,从而在父容器内对其他所有子元素应用样式。通过结合使用多个选择器参数,我们能够克服:not选择器在排除整个子树时的局限性,实现更精细的样式控制,并辅以代码示例详细解析其工作原理。

    html教程 5612025-09-08 13:48:01

  • 使用 CSS 和复选框控制元素显示:进阶教程

    使用 CSS 和复选框控制元素显示:进阶教程

    本教程旨在讲解如何利用CSS和HTML复选框的:checked伪类选择器来动态控制页面元素的显示与隐藏。我们将深入探讨CSS选择器的作用范围,并通过实际示例演示如何巧妙地使用Flexbox布局和兄弟选择器,实现复选框状态改变时,隐藏或显示特定元素的效果。本教程适用于对CSS选择器和Flexbox布局有一定了解的开发者。

    html教程 5922025-09-06 22:30:03

  • CSS表格鼠标悬停颜色怎么改_CSS表格鼠标悬停颜色修改教程

    CSS表格鼠标悬停颜色怎么改_CSS表格鼠标悬停颜色修改教程

    要改变CSS表格鼠标悬停时的颜色,需使用:hover伪类选择器作用于tr或td元素,并通过background-color属性实现变色效果。通常推荐对tbody下的tr应用:hover,以高亮整行提升可读性,同时可配合cursor:pointer和transition属性增强交互体验。此外,悬停时还可调整文字颜色、边框、阴影、变换等样式,结合过渡效果使变化更自然。对于嵌套表格,应利用子选择器>或提高选择器特异性避免样式冲突,并为嵌套结构单独设置规则。在移动端,因无悬停概念,应侧重:active状

    css教程 8252025-09-06 18:15:01

  • CSS表格内边距如何调整_CSS表格内边距调整技巧分享

    CSS表格内边距如何调整_CSS表格内边距调整技巧分享

    调整CSS表格内边距主要通过padding属性实现,可全局设置或使用选择器针对特定行、列、单元格精细化控制,推荐使用CSS类而非内联样式以提升维护性;当padding无效时,需检查border-collapse、样式冲突、选择器优先级及HTML结构;响应式内边距可通过媒体查询或CSS变量实现;内边距、边框与单元格间距共同影响表格布局,其中border-spacing仅在border-collapse为separate时生效;必要时可用JavaScript动态修改style.padding属性,但

    css教程 2862025-09-06 16:58:14

  • CSS表格边框粗细怎么修改_CSS表格边框粗细修改技巧

    CSS表格边框粗细怎么修改_CSS表格边框粗细修改技巧

    修改CSS表格边框粗细需使用border-width属性,并结合border-style、border-color及border-collapse:collapse;避免边框重叠。通过设置table、th、td的border或border-width,可精确控制整体或局部边框粗细,如表头加粗、外边框加粗等。使用简写属性border可同时定义宽度、样式和颜色,提升代码简洁性与视觉效果。

    css教程 3812025-09-06 15:18:03

热门阅读

关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号